My netperf results (3 sec samples) are: TCP_MAERTS Test: 13.60 14.41 16.05 15.01 14.70 15.36 14.72 15.07 12.37 11.01 Results: max 16.05, min 11.01. Mean 14.23(1.44) TCP_STREAM Test: 3.00 1.89 1.23 2.12 0.91 1.59 1.46 0.71 1.99 2.12 Results: max 3.00, min 0.71. Mean 1.70(0.64) As you can see, RX is OK, but TX is quite low.
